On the idyllic Lavant cycle path R10, a beautiful bee education area has been created that provides information. It is worth taking the time to visit it.

St. Paul Abbey in Lavanttal is a monastery of the Benedictine Order in Lower Carinthia, founded in 1091. Its buildings stand on a rocky outcrop at the transition from the middle to the lower Lavant Valley.
